Do credit card advantages outweigh the extra expenses?

You don’t have to worry about change. One of the things that drives me crazy about paying with cash is all the change in my pocket. When I go to buy something I find myself digging around for change because I don’t want more, but then I feel like an old lady who is holding up everyone in the store.

I often just give a larger bill and fill my pockets with even more annoying change. • Book keeping is easier. With cash if you lose your receipt, the record of your purchase has gone MIA (unless you have an incredible memory – which I don’t).

My wife and I were trying to sort out some of our bills earlier today and I caught myself thinking that if we had just bought it with a credit card we would instantaneously know how much we spent. • Purchasing items for business. Where I work we use a reimbursement policy.

I buy it now and they pay me later. Having a credit card for those types of purchases avoids forwarding any cash. It gives time for a check to be cut before the payment is due.
